This time next year you can travel with the stars on the Hogwarts Express at the first ever mobile signing event! This brand new concept in mobile signing events will start at London Euston station at 10am, travel to Birmingham New Street, then return to London by 5.30pm. You can join at either station or stay on the train for the whole trip (discounted tickets are available for one way travel).

Obviously it will be difficult to have all the attendees walking up and down the carriages (the corridors are quite narrow) so we have arranged for you to stay in your seats and bring the guests to meet you! (Any of you who have been to a Massive Events gold pass drinks reception will know how this works). Yes, the guests will stop at every table to sign autographs and have a brief chat with you, before moving on to the next table/carriage.

We have also been able to organise a photo shoot area in the end carriage and a talk area at the front of the train (seating is limited), so this will be just like other Collectormania events, only it will be run in both London and Birmingham at the same time!

There will be two types of ticket available, first (gold) class and second (standard) class. The first class ticket will entitle you to your own private carriage (seats 6) whilst the second class ticket gives you a seat in the main, open carriages. There will also be a dining car on the train. Travel tickets will be on sale on our online shop shortly and photo shoots will be added as soon as our first guests are announced.

So why not join us on a adventure this time next year as Collectormania goes mobile! Don't forget to add the date to your diaries. 1/4/2013. And check out the website for more information.

It was of course an April Fools. Congratulations all those who figured it out!
As much fun as the event would be, it would be a logistical nightmare. Anyone who has tried to write on a train will know just how wobbly the signatures would be, and I don't think even Malcolm would be able to shoot a straight photo on a moving vehicle!
